Impressions describe the number of times your material is displayed to individuals. Unlike reach, which focuses on special individuals, impacts count each time your web content appears on someone's screen, whether they see it or otherwise. Twitter does not offer reach metrics, yet only impacts metrics. Impressions are the variety of times your tweet is displayed, whether it is clicked or not. You can locate this metric in your Twitter Analytics control panel, under the Tweets tab.
